How Long Does Viagra Last in Your System?

Viagra typically remains effective for 4-6 hours after taking, though this varies between individuals. The duration depends on several factors including dosage strength, your metabolism, age, and overall health. Higher doses (100mg) may provide longer-lasting effects compared to lower strengths (25mg or 50mg). It's important to understand that Viagra lasting "4-6 hours" doesn't mean you'll have an erection for this entire period - rather, it's the window during which the medication can help you achieve and maintain an erection when sexually aroused.

Viagra Connect Duration and Limitations

Viagra Connect contains 50mg sildenafil and typically lasts around 4 hours. As an over-the-counter option, it offers convenience but lacks the flexibility of prescription treatments. The fixed 50mg dose may not be optimal for everyone - some men require 25mg due to side effects, whilst others benefit from 100mg for better effectiveness. Connect also requires face-to-face pharmacy consultation and isn't suitable for men taking certain medications or with specific health conditions.

Prescription Viagra: Tailored Duration and Dosing

Prescription Viagra offers three strengths (25mg, 50mg, 100mg), allowing healthcare professionals to tailor treatment based on your individual needs and response. Men who find 50mg insufficient can be prescribed 100mg for potentially longer duration and better effectiveness. Conversely, those experiencing side effects can try 25mg whilst still receiving therapeutic benefits. This personalised approach often results in better treatment outcomes compared to the one-size-fits-all approach of over-the-counter options.

Factors Affecting How Long Viagra Lasts

Several factors influence Viagra's duration in your system. Food intake significantly impacts absorption - fatty meals can delay onset by up to 60 minutes and may reduce peak effectiveness. Alcohol consumption can also diminish effects and delay absorption. Age plays a role, with older men (over 65) often experiencing longer-lasting effects due to slower metabolism. Certain medications, particularly those affecting liver enzymes, can alter how quickly your body processes sildenafil, potentially extending or reducing duration.

What is Erectile Dysfunction?
ED means finding it hard to get or keep an erection firm enough for sex. It's not unusual to have an off night; the point at which it's worth doing something is when it's happening regularly, or when it's starting to bother you.
How will I feel when I take ED medication?
For most men, nothing feels different day to day. The medication works in the background — when you're sexually aroused, it helps blood flow where it's needed, so erections come more easily and last longer. It doesn't cause arousal on its own. Some men notice mild, short-lived effects like a headache, facial flushing or a stuffy nose, which usually pass as the dose wears off.
